I answered this a few posts up. Post number 1881. You want to gear your car so that the motor doesn't get too hot. Most people use 160 degrees fahrenheit as the danger zone. Using the gearing above, you should be safe. If you don't have a temp gun, use your finger. If you can't hold your finger in the motor for a couple of seconds, it's getting too hot. If it gets too how, use a smaller pinion.

oops forgot the fact that you need a 3.5 BL.
Careful on the ESC temps though, 4 or 5 full speed passes was enough to melt the motor wires out of my GTB (no fan though). Motor was pretty warm maybe about 140-150..
